WebBy the time the nearly 10-year program ended at 199 flights in October 1968, an X-15 had been flown to a blistering speed of Mach 6.7 (4,520 mph), a record that still stands for …
Web18 feb. 2024 · X-15 is a hypersonic гoсket aircraft designed and built by North American for NACA (later NASA) testing. It set speed records in the 1960s that remain unbroken some … Web15 aug. 2024 · The top speed of the X-15 was 4,520 mph (7,274 km/h) Mach 6.7. It reached this speed during flight number 188 on October 3, 1967, at an altitude of 19.3 mi (31.1 …
Web12 jan. 2024 · Three X-15s were built. Designed X-15-1, -2 and -3. Each was used in a various number of flights.
